1991 Ford Mustang vs. 1981 Toyota Celica

To start off, 1991 Ford Mustang is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1981 Toyota Celica.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1981 Toyota Celica would be higher. At 2,562 cc, 1981 Toyota Celica is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1981 Toyota Celica (118 HP @ 5400 RPM) has 12 more horse power than 1991 Ford Mustang. (106 HP @ 4600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1981 Toyota Celica should accelerate faster than 1991 Ford Mustang.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1991 Ford Mustang weights approximately 80 kg more than 1981 Toyota Celica.

Let's talk about torque, 1981 Toyota Celica (215 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 32 more torque (in Nm) than 1991 Ford Mustang. (183 Nm @ 2600 RPM). This means 1981 Toyota Celica will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1991 Ford Mustang.
